Problem Solving Behaviour of Junior High Schools Students to Solve Problem of Higher Order Thinking
Y Harisman

Universitas Negeri Padang


Abstract

This study discusses the problem-solving problem of junior high school students in solving debates that are classified as HOTS problems. One hundred thirty-nine junior high school students from 5 different junior high schools were used as research subjects. Each student is given a HOTS question. Students are also interviewed with open questions about the results of their answers. Student answer sheets, as well as the results of student interviews are corrected and transcribed then grouped according to the rubric category mathematical problem solving. Based on the results of the study, obtained by high school students on research subjects on average behave naively and routinely in solving HOTS problems.

Keywords: HOTS, Behavior, Mathematical Problem Solving, Students, Middle Schools
